YOUR BODY NEEDS MORE WATER WHEN YOU ARE:
- In hot climates
- More physically active
- Running a fever
- Having diarrhea or vomiting

BENEFITS:
- Regulates your body temperature
- Removes waste
- Helps your body absorb nutrients
- Cushions your joints
- Helps convert food to energy
- Helps deliver oxygen all over the body
- Allows body's cells to grow, reproduce, and survive
- Promotes weight-loss
- Improves skin complexion
- Boosts immune system
- Prevents cramps and sprains
- Relieves fatigue

- Carry a water bottle for easy access wherever you are
- Freeze some water bottles. Take one with you for ice-cold water all day long.
- Choose water instead of sugar-sweetened beverages. This can also help with weight management. Substituting water for one 20-ounce sugar sweetened soda will save you about 240 calories.
- Choose water when eating out. Generally, you will save money and reduce calories.
- Add a wedge of lime or lemon to your water. This can help improve the taste and help you drink more water than you usually do.
- Keep another glass next to your bed. Many of us wake up dehydrated first thing in the morning.
- Switch one glass of soda or cup of coffee for a glass of water.
- Drink small amounts of water throughout the day. Six glasses all at once isn’t good for you!
- Drink water before each meal
